SIGNIFICANCE OF EXTERNAL AUDITOR’S ON THE EXAMINATION OF FINANCIAL STATEMENT



This study was to assess the significance external auditor?s in the examination of  financial statement  of  first  Bank  of  Nigeria  Plc., Enugu.  The banking sector in Nigeria and elsewhere in recent times have become so diversified, challenging, highly competitive and  has  been  characterized  by  persistent,  fraud,  errors  and misappropriation of funds in the bank, the impact of which has undoubtedly shaken the whole economy of the nation. For this work to be effectively and efficiently carried out the use of primary and secondary methods was adopted for the collection of data, where  in  primary  data,  the  researcher  designed  and  advanced questionnaires to first Bank Enugu for collection of primary data while  secondary    data  was  gotten  from  textbooks,  journals, manuals  lecture  notes,  etc.  the  data  collected  from  the questionnaire was analyzed  in tables with simple percentage and interpreted  for  the  understanding  of  the  study  the  formulated hypothesis were tested using Z – test formula.   The result of the study  shows  that,  external  auditors  examination  of  first  banks financial statement or records aids in checking and monitoring as well as stopping frauds errors, misappropriation of funds in the Banks.  Recommendations were made to the management of First Bank of Nigeria Plc, Abuja.
